A Department of Corrections investigation has resulted in multiple arrests and resignations at Angola since the investigation began last Friday. Department spokesperson Ken Pastorick says the accused employees are facing a wide ran allegations.
“Six of these individuals had inappropriate relationships going on with inmates. And then we had one individual who had been working to conspire with inmates and their families to smuggle contraband into the facility,” said Pastorick.
Of those involved in the investigation, six were sergeants and one was a nurse. Pastorick says more arrests are expected as the investigation continues.
“We have four that have been arrested by the West Feliciana Parish Sheriff’s Office. Three others are under investigation with charges pending,” said Pastorick.
Pastorick says the department will continue to crack down on those who choose to betray the public’s trust.
“We’ll prosecute to the fullest extent of the law. This is not a reflection of the many hard working men and women in our department who are dedicated to keeping our department and public safe,” said Pastorick.
